Join Flow Gallery’s Yvonna Demczynska and Alina Young on an entirely new itinerary through Japan. We travel south from Tokyo into the ancient kiln town of Tokoname, then on through Kyoto and deep into Kyushu, the volcanic southern island whose craft traditions are rarely visited by international travellers. Along the ancient kiln towns and folk-craft villages we meet ceramicists, basket weavers, metalworkers, textile artists, wood and lacquer craftsmen and glassmakers in their own studios, with private access rarely extended to visitors. Alongside the making, we take in the museums, temples and gardens behind these crafts, and eat together at tables where Japan’s regional cuisines complete the picture.
